عرض المزيد2.2 Sublevel Caving Mining Method. Sublevel caving is one of the most advanced mining methods. This method is usually undertaken when mining the ore body through an open pit is no longer economically viable. In sublevel caving, mining starts at the top of the ore body and develops downwards.

عرض المزيدMuch of the theory upon which the Sublevel Caving (SLC) method is based was developed in Scandinavia many years ago. It was based mainly on bin' theory and ellipsoid of draw' configurations derived from sandbox models. In many cases, classical SLC layouts influenced by these early theories obtained relatively poor results. Early dilution entry, …

عرض المزيدOther articles where sublevel caving is discussed: mining: Sublevel caving: This method owes the first part of its name to the fact that work is carried out on many intermediate levels (that is, sublevels) between the main levels. The second half of the name derives from the caving of the hanging wall and…

عرض المزيدThe layout of ore blocks and extracting technology are generally similar to that of sublevel caving method with sill pillar and external force of drilling blasting is required for caving. The method belongs to one-step mining, which is characterized by caving at one time in the whole stage height without sublevels.

عرض المزيدMining - Blasthole Stoping, Ore Extraction, Drilling: When the dip of a deposit is steep (greater than about 55°), ore and waste strong, ore boundaries regular, and the deposit relatively thick, a system called blasthole stoping is used. A drift is driven along the bottom of the ore body, and this is eventually enlarged into the shape of a trough. At …

عرض المزيدBlock caving is an extreme case of sublevel caving in which instead of a back of ore 5 to 10 ft. thick, one 50 ft. thick is undermined and allowed to cave. The method is illustrated in Fig. 7. After the bottom of the block, or panel, is cut up into pillars by drift's and cross drifts, the pillars are robbed, and then the remaining stumps are ...

عرض المزيدSurface subsidence is a geological hazard resulting from sublevel caving (Chen et al. 2016). Sublevel caving is a mass mining method based on utilizing the gravity flow of the blasted ore and caved waste rock. Sublevel caving without sill pillars is the main mining method used in underground metal mines in China (Li et al. 2006). …
